My Tips for Making Chocolate Truffles

Making chocolate truffles can be quite the process. But, I've learned that it doesn't need to be difficult. Making chocolate of any kind is a wonderful thing - the way it smells, the way it melts, the way it tastes... I just love it.

The basic recipe for truffles involves butter, cream, and chocolate all melted together over a double burner.

But, don't try to wing it - especially not at first. Last time I tried to remember how to make them on my own, the truffle filling was a runny mess. Instead, follow a recipe like the one I have provided below.
